该文综述了近年来有关海洋无脊椎动物——柳珊瑚的化学成分与生物活性研究,收载了期间所报道的432个新化合物,包括46个倍半萜(含2个新天然产物),281个二萜(含1人工产物和4个海笔目八放珊瑚二萜),76个甾体,29个生物碱及其他(包括2个新天然产物)。根据化合物结构类型和柳珊瑚的科属分类进行阐述,对相关的生物活性做同步分析。重点阐述新骨架和复杂结构的特征、鉴定方法和可能的生源途径,对新化合物的来源和二萜的结构类型进行了分类,首次提出部分二萜骨架的中文译名。柳珊瑚的生物活性研究包括抗肿瘤(细胞毒)、抗炎、抗菌(金葡菌、结核杆菌等)、抗疟疾、抗污损等多方面,从中详细总结了对肿瘤细胞的细胞毒(或抑制)活性,并对柳珊瑚的化学和生物活性研究做相关讨论与展望,以期为我国柳珊瑚化学和生物活性研究、柳珊瑚化学生态学研究及海洋药物先导化合物的发现提供一定的参考。
